Cellosaurus MOLM-7 (CVCL_7917)

Cell line name MOLM-7
Synonyms MOLM7
Accession CVCL_7917
Resource Identification Initiative To cite this cell line use: MOLM-7 (RRID:CVCL_7917)
Comments Population: Japanese.
Microsatellite instability: Stable (MSS) (PubMed=10739008; PubMed=11226526).
Derived from site: In situ; Peripheral blood; UBERON=UBERON_0000178.
Sequence variations
  • Mutation; HGNC; 2468; SMC3; Simple; p.Arg661Pro (c.1982G>C); ClinVar=VCV001310284; Zygosity=Unspecified (PubMed=23955599).
Disease Chronic myelogenous leukemia, BCR-ABL1 positive (NCIt: C3174)
Chronic myeloid leukemia (ORDO: Orphanet_521)
Species of origin Homo sapiens (Human) (NCBI Taxonomy: 9606)
Originate from same individual CVCL_2122 ! MOLM-6
CVCL_7918 ! MOLM-8
CVCL_7919 ! MOLM-9
CVCL_7920 ! MOLM-10
CVCL_7921 ! MOLM-11
CVCL_L075 ! MOLM-12
Sex of cell Male
Age at sampling 44Y
Category Cancer cell line
